I do. I'm about 20 minutes away from Winsted in Granby CT. Even though there are no stripers here in Connecticut , I do manage to get out every weekend to waste my time trying (ha!). I now do most of my fishing from boat, but still manage to hit the surf now and then. I fish from Old Saybrook to Watch Hill RI in my boat. You're going to want to check out the spring striper run up the Connecticut River. From Winsted you can get to the Enfield Dam in just over a half hour, where you will find stripers stacked up chasing herring from late April to late May. If you're into trout fishing, the Farimington River is about 10 minutes max from Winsted. West Hill Pond in Winsted is good for trout, smb, ice fishing,ect
